Cratichneumon coruscator is a species of the parasitic wasp family Ichneumonidae.
Contents
Description
Cratichneumon coruscator can reach a length of 9–14 millimetres (0.35–0.55 in) in males, of 7–11 millimetres (0.28–0.43 in) in females. Adults can be found from May to August. Larvae feed on Panolis flammea and other Noctuidae.
Distribution and habitat
This species is present in most of Europe, in the Near East and in the Oriental ecozone. It lives in hedge rows.
